Frequently Asked Questions
How does VoxBee compare to MacWhisper on price?+
MacWhisper has a free basic tier and a $30 Pro version. VoxBee is $39 (early bird) or $49. VoxBee includes dictation, meeting recording, and URL transcription that MacWhisper doesn't have.
What does VoxBee have that MacWhisper doesn't?+
Push-to-talk dictation (voice typing in any app), meeting recording with AI summaries, URL transcription from 1,800+ sites, grammar correction, filler word removal, personal dictionary, and Linux support.
Does VoxBee support the same audio formats?+
Yes. VoxBee handles MP3, WAV, M4A, MP4, MOV, and more. It also supports URLs that MacWhisper can't transcribe.
Is VoxBee's transcription quality the same as MacWhisper?+
Both use OpenAI's Whisper models locally. VoxBee uses WhisperKit optimized for Apple Silicon with 7 models to choose from.
Can VoxBee batch-transcribe multiple files?+
Yes. Queue up multiple files or URLs. VoxBee processes them sequentially and yields priority to live dictation between chunks.
Does VoxBee have a free tier?+
VoxBee offers a 14-day free trial with all features — no account, no credit card. After that, it's a one-time purchase.
